Just a little heads up Sam, on my plane with a DA100 and stock mufflers I was very nose heavy. I put two 2600 li-on packs back against the rudder post,rudder servo under the left stab and still added 2 oz's to the tail. I guess if I used two rudder servos back there I would'nt need the lead. Even if it is only a pound of weight savings, that is 1 pound less that goes up in the air. It will be interesting to see how much the servos at the back and the weight savings you did does to the CG. Mine balanced at the recommended CG point, but the 3 batteries, two rudder servos and Eq6 are all fairly close together at the back in order to get that. I would be nicer if you can spread them out a bit, there is a lot of room to do that.
